Lintian Fixes - libfreenect

Ready changes

Merge these changes:

git pull https://janitor.debian.net/git/libfreenect lintian-fixes

Summary

Diff

=== modified file 'debian/changelog'
--- a/debian/changelog	2016-01-02 03:37:38 +0000
+++ b/debian/changelog	2020-06-25 17:12:33 +0000
@@ -1,3 +1,20 @@
+libfreenect (1:0.5.3-2) UNRELEASED; urgency=low
+
+  * Trim trailing whitespace.
+  * Use secure copyright file specification URI.
+  * debian/copyright: use spaces rather than tabs to start continuation lines.
+  * Add missing build dependency on dh addon.
+  * Bump debhelper from deprecated 9 to 12.
+  * Set debhelper-compat version in Build-Depends.
+  * Change priority extra to priority optional.
+  * Set upstream metadata fields: Bug-Database, Bug-Submit, Repository,
+    Repository-Browse.
+  * Update Vcs-* headers to use salsa repository.
+  * Fix day-of-week for changelog entries 0.0.20101122-0ubuntu2~lucid,
+    0.0.20101122-0ubuntu2~maverick, 0.0.20101122-0ubuntu1~lucid.
+
+ -- Debian Janitor <janitor@jelmer.uk>  Thu, 25 Jun 2020 17:05:47 -0000
+
 libfreenect (1:0.5.3-1) unstable; urgency=medium
 
   * Recent upstream bugfix release
@@ -106,9 +123,9 @@
 
   [ Nicolas Bourdaud ]
   * Improved the package description.
-  * Drop outdated libglut3-dev from Build-Depends 
-  * Add libfreenect-doc to the dependencies of freenect metapackage 
-  * Remove the paragraph about conflict with kernel module in README.Debian 
+  * Drop outdated libglut3-dev from Build-Depends
+  * Add libfreenect-doc to the dependencies of freenect metapackage
+  * Remove the paragraph about conflict with kernel module in README.Debian
 
  -- Yaroslav Halchenko <debian@onerussian.com>  Sun, 12 Feb 2012 19:00:15 -0500
 
@@ -158,7 +175,7 @@
   * Rename libfreenect-demos into libfreenect-bin and add utilities to it.
   * Stop shipping static libraries
   * Update Vcs-* fields in debian/control
-  
+
   [ Yaroslav Halchenko ]
   * python-freenect: Added module frame_convert.py within examples
 
@@ -250,7 +267,7 @@
 libfreenect (1:0.0.1+20101211-1) UNRELEASED; urgency=low
 
   * Boost of policy compliance to 3.9.1 -- no changes are due
-  * Fix: disable cmake deduction of library path alternation 
+  * Fix: disable cmake deduction of library path alternation
     -- should go under /usr/lib for all architectures.
 
  -- Arne Bernin <arne@alamut.de>  Sat, 11 Dec 2010 21:37:28 +0100
@@ -272,19 +289,19 @@
 
   * fixed typo in changelog
 
- -- Arne Bernin <arne@alamut.de>  Fri, 22 Nov 2010 14:41:01 +0100
+ -- Arne Bernin <arne@alamut.de>  Mon, 22 Nov 2010 14:41:01 +0100
 
 libfreenect (0.0.20101122-0ubuntu2~maverick) maverick; urgency=low
 
   * added c++ api + code cleanups from upstream
 
- -- Arne Bernin <arne@alamut.de>  Fri, 22 Nov 2010 14:41:01 +0100
+ -- Arne Bernin <arne@alamut.de>  Mon, 22 Nov 2010 14:41:01 +0100
 
 libfreenect (0.0.20101122-0ubuntu1~lucid) maverick; urgency=low
 
   * added c++ api + code cleanups from upstream
 
- -- Arne Bernin <arne@alamut.de>  Fri, 22 Nov 2010 14:41:01 +0100
+ -- Arne Bernin <arne@alamut.de>  Mon, 22 Nov 2010 14:41:01 +0100
 
 libfreenect (0.0.20101119-0ubuntu2~maverick) maverick; urgency=low
 
@@ -331,6 +348,6 @@
 
 libfreenect (0.0.1-1) lucid; urgency=low
 
-  * Initial release 
+  * Initial release
 
  -- Arne Bernin <arne@alamut.de>  Wed, 17 Nov 2010 21:26:12 +0100

=== removed file 'debian/compat'
--- a/debian/compat	2012-05-22 13:09:30 +0000
+++ b/debian/compat	1970-01-01 00:00:00 +0000
@@ -1,1 +0,0 @@
-9

=== modified file 'debian/control'
--- a/debian/control	2015-04-29 13:19:56 +0000
+++ b/debian/control	2020-06-25 17:11:52 +0000
@@ -1,16 +1,16 @@
 Source: libfreenect
 Section: libdevel
-Priority: extra
+Priority: optional
 Maintainer: Nicolas Bourdaud <nicolas.bourdaud@gmail.com>
 Uploaders: Arne Bernin <arne@alamut.de>, Yaroslav Halchenko <debian@onerussian.com>, Mark Renouf <mark.renouf@gmail.com>
-Build-Depends: debhelper (>= 9), cmake,  pkg-config,
- libusb-1.0-0-dev(>= 1.0.18~), freeglut3-dev, libxmu-dev, libxi-dev,
- python-all-dev (>= 2.6.6-3~), cython, python-numpy, doxygen
+Build-Depends: debhelper-compat (= 12), cmake,  pkg-config,
+ libusb-1.0-0-dev (>= 1.0.18~), freeglut3-dev, libxmu-dev, libxi-dev,
+ python-all-dev (>= 2.6.6-3~), cython, python-numpy, doxygen, dh-python
 X-Python-Version: 2.7
 Standards-Version: 3.9.6
 Homepage: http://openkinect.org/
-Vcs-Git: git://anonscm.debian.org/pkg-exppsy/libfreenect.git
-Vcs-Browser: http://anonscm.debian.org/gitweb/?p=pkg-exppsy/libfreenect.git
+Vcs-Git: https://salsa.debian.org/neurodebian-team/libfreenect.git
+Vcs-Browser: https://salsa.debian.org/neurodebian-team/libfreenect
 
 Package: libfreenect0.5
 Section: libs

=== modified file 'debian/copyright'
--- a/debian/copyright	2015-01-20 19:01:44 +0000
+++ b/debian/copyright	2020-06-25 17:07:29 +0000
@@ -1,4 +1,4 @@
-Format: http://www.debian.org/doc/packaging-manuals/copyright-format/1.0/
+Format: https://www.debian.org/doc/packaging-manuals/copyright-format/1.0/
 Upstream-Name: libfreenect
 Upstream-Contact: openkinect@googlegroups.com
 Source: https://github.com/OpenKinect/libfreenect
@@ -58,7 +58,7 @@
 
 Files: wrappers/ruby/ffi-libfreenect
 Copyright: 2010, Josh Grunzweig & Eric Monti
-		   2011, Alex Weiss <algrs@cacography.net>
+ 		   2011, Alex Weiss <algrs@cacography.net>
 License: Expat
 
 Files: src/fwfetcher.py
@@ -72,7 +72,7 @@
 Files: debian/*
 Copyright: 2010, arne <arne@alamut.de>
            2010-2015, Yaroslav Halchenko <debian@onerussian.com>
-	       2012, Nicolas Bourdaud <nicolas.bourdaud@gmail.com>
+ 	       2012, Nicolas Bourdaud <nicolas.bourdaud@gmail.com>
 License: GPL-2
 
 License: GPL-2

=== added directory 'debian/upstream'
=== added file 'debian/upstream/metadata'
--- a/debian/upstream/metadata	1970-01-01 00:00:00 +0000
+++ b/debian/upstream/metadata	2020-06-25 17:11:05 +0000
@@ -0,0 +1,5 @@
+---
+Bug-Database: https://github.com/OpenKinect/libfreenect/issues
+Bug-Submit: https://github.com/OpenKinect/libfreenect/issues/new
+Repository: https://github.com/OpenKinect/libfreenect.git
+Repository-Browse: https://github.com/OpenKinect/libfreenect

Debdiff

[The following lists of changes regard files as different if they have different names, permissions or owners.]

Files in second set of .debs but not in first

-rw-r--r--  root/root   /usr/lib/debug/.build-id/06/dbc24f4243d3de5aa3978aa5a2d682df074d70.debug
-rw-r--r--  root/root   /usr/lib/debug/.build-id/2c/a61649fd1910c0047301514a18552399924fbc.debug
-rw-r--r--  root/root   /usr/lib/debug/.build-id/35/d23881f6bca711f02b915612a8590fdb581118.debug
-rw-r--r--  root/root   /usr/lib/debug/.build-id/37/db0d6c34bef0ea5baf28ceb6abee7a4bc4d069.debug
-rw-r--r--  root/root   /usr/lib/debug/.build-id/46/d93d76777e5d2ddf7487a9409d8f80dc7b394e.debug
-rw-r--r--  root/root   /usr/lib/debug/.build-id/4d/8aa5a97cdb4bcf7ec8a476eea28ac5d3036ea4.debug
-rw-r--r--  root/root   /usr/lib/debug/.build-id/52/6ea686cc99a958cc02f8d70716295e754d1d6c.debug
-rw-r--r--  root/root   /usr/lib/debug/.build-id/56/38dad89552a234614d14e5b68b86ade9ab185f.debug
-rw-r--r--  root/root   /usr/lib/debug/.build-id/69/add6273dd3b13790e078534dea927375d45056.debug
-rw-r--r--  root/root   /usr/lib/debug/.build-id/83/2f33550d874e92afb993aeb7a87109afb4fc7c.debug
-rw-r--r--  root/root   /usr/lib/debug/.build-id/91/929d0235b1f3e6bbe09e64b710d58a85fbc35c.debug
-rw-r--r--  root/root   /usr/lib/debug/.build-id/a9/abb32e861c1127db41817894d13749760a741e.debug
-rw-r--r--  root/root   /usr/lib/debug/.build-id/c1/20c344d35e8a94b08c28754058156176ec708f.debug
-rw-r--r--  root/root   /usr/lib/debug/.build-id/ce/16403eae58d8e9458428291c4d79bef7e71255.debug
-rw-r--r--  root/root   /usr/lib/debug/.build-id/ed/00803e6b30159b630810d74aca0837e94aa3cb.debug
-rw-r--r--  root/root   /usr/lib/debug/.build-id/ed/a0ac7ccb363c2ef66777be71e477a5ebcf6bd5.debug
-rw-r--r--  root/root   /usr/lib/debug/.dwz/x86_64-linux-gnu/libfreenect-bin.debug
-rw-r--r--  root/root   /usr/lib/debug/.dwz/x86_64-linux-gnu/libfreenect0.5.debug
-rw-r--r--  root/root   /usr/lib/python2.7/dist-packages/freenect.x86_64-linux-gnu.so
-rw-r--r--  root/root   /usr/share/doc/libfreenect-dev/examples/camtest.c
-rw-r--r--  root/root   /usr/share/doc/libfreenect-dev/examples/chunkview.c
-rw-r--r--  root/root   /usr/share/doc/libfreenect-dev/examples/cppview.cpp
-rw-r--r--  root/root   /usr/share/doc/libfreenect-dev/examples/glpclview.c
-rw-r--r--  root/root   /usr/share/doc/libfreenect-dev/examples/glview.c
-rw-r--r--  root/root   /usr/share/doc/libfreenect-dev/examples/hiview.c
-rw-r--r--  root/root   /usr/share/doc/libfreenect-dev/examples/micview.c
-rw-r--r--  root/root   /usr/share/doc/libfreenect-dev/examples/regtest.c
-rw-r--r--  root/root   /usr/share/doc/libfreenect-dev/examples/regview.c
-rw-r--r--  root/root   /usr/share/doc/libfreenect-dev/examples/tiltdemo.c
-rw-r--r--  root/root   /usr/share/doc/libfreenect-dev/examples/wavrecord.c

Files in first set of .debs but not in second

-rw-r--r--  root/root   /usr/lib/debug/.build-id/0b/fff7682aafdf22dd0ef626ebc65ceb134010fb.debug
-rw-r--r--  root/root   /usr/lib/debug/.build-id/1d/be9605dfbff69a63ca24873b2ddb01984cf4b6.debug
-rw-r--r--  root/root   /usr/lib/debug/.build-id/2d/ec7c62a3faaca6f35200a8e3455bfd294827fe.debug
-rw-r--r--  root/root   /usr/lib/debug/.build-id/44/549963e2cf16eedca0b1e342f8fca72a3ca42a.debug
-rw-r--r--  root/root   /usr/lib/debug/.build-id/44/ec78c4cf7be4e098a35970713de900039fcbfc.debug
-rw-r--r--  root/root   /usr/lib/debug/.build-id/54/a6422c230e99c4b7658ddf1cc024fc08d52436.debug
-rw-r--r--  root/root   /usr/lib/debug/.build-id/5b/23091c1586a4cbd8ceea3ad2b519edb64bec4e.debug
-rw-r--r--  root/root   /usr/lib/debug/.build-id/66/47fdd8a970ceac4b9590a6e23f26daf9ee64a7.debug
-rw-r--r--  root/root   /usr/lib/debug/.build-id/6d/df0bf00aa0e59c837ecac2155527c1fdc2e967.debug
-rw-r--r--  root/root   /usr/lib/debug/.build-id/7c/647749016890499c7792408651f9fec12b01aa.debug
-rw-r--r--  root/root   /usr/lib/debug/.build-id/81/e86d6aa157527caf854fde077fb9dd5baca345.debug
-rw-r--r--  root/root   /usr/lib/debug/.build-id/8f/dda28ebfd6b66e329d530918ef3f031fe2c8b6.debug
-rw-r--r--  root/root   /usr/lib/debug/.build-id/9a/fca887bf92430756f7dc8532fa13a54ee41df9.debug
-rw-r--r--  root/root   /usr/lib/debug/.build-id/c6/2487695fb1c43adfe57f855c9d166cc91d1ccb.debug
-rw-r--r--  root/root   /usr/lib/debug/.build-id/c8/efb9bbc87996ee951ecfb992f59738e114e372.debug
-rw-r--r--  root/root   /usr/lib/debug/.build-id/de/b434bc03f073e4419df32f2cd635614a47bf89.debug
-rw-r--r--  root/root   /usr/lib/python2.7/dist-packages/freenect.so
-rw-r--r--  root/root   /usr/share/doc/libfreenect-doc/examples/camtest.c
-rw-r--r--  root/root   /usr/share/doc/libfreenect-doc/examples/chunkview.c.gz
-rw-r--r--  root/root   /usr/share/doc/libfreenect-doc/examples/cppview.cpp.gz
-rw-r--r--  root/root   /usr/share/doc/libfreenect-doc/examples/glpclview.c.gz
-rw-r--r--  root/root   /usr/share/doc/libfreenect-doc/examples/glview.c.gz
-rw-r--r--  root/root   /usr/share/doc/libfreenect-doc/examples/hiview.c.gz
-rw-r--r--  root/root   /usr/share/doc/libfreenect-doc/examples/micview.c.gz
-rw-r--r--  root/root   /usr/share/doc/libfreenect-doc/examples/regtest.c
-rw-r--r--  root/root   /usr/share/doc/libfreenect-doc/examples/regview.c.gz
-rw-r--r--  root/root   /usr/share/doc/libfreenect-doc/examples/tiltdemo.c.gz
-rw-r--r--  root/root   /usr/share/doc/libfreenect-doc/examples/wavrecord.c.gz

Control files of package freenect: lines which differ (wdiff format)

  • Priority: extra optional

Control files of package libfreenect-bin: lines which differ (wdiff format)

  • Priority: extra optional

Control files of package libfreenect-bin-dbgsym: lines which differ (wdiff format)

  • Build-Ids: 0bfff7682aafdf22dd0ef626ebc65ceb134010fb 1dbe9605dfbff69a63ca24873b2ddb01984cf4b6 2dec7c62a3faaca6f35200a8e3455bfd294827fe 44ec78c4cf7be4e098a35970713de900039fcbfc 54a6422c230e99c4b7658ddf1cc024fc08d52436 6647fdd8a970ceac4b9590a6e23f26daf9ee64a7 6ddf0bf00aa0e59c837ecac2155527c1fdc2e967 7c647749016890499c7792408651f9fec12b01aa 81e86d6aa157527caf854fde077fb9dd5baca345 8fdda28ebfd6b66e329d530918ef3f031fe2c8b6 9afca887bf92430756f7dc8532fa13a54ee41df9 c62487695fb1c43adfe57f855c9d166cc91d1ccb c8efb9bbc87996ee951ecfb992f59738e114e372 06dbc24f4243d3de5aa3978aa5a2d682df074d70 2ca61649fd1910c0047301514a18552399924fbc 37db0d6c34bef0ea5baf28ceb6abee7a4bc4d069 46d93d76777e5d2ddf7487a9409d8f80dc7b394e 4d8aa5a97cdb4bcf7ec8a476eea28ac5d3036ea4 526ea686cc99a958cc02f8d70716295e754d1d6c 5638dad89552a234614d14e5b68b86ade9ab185f 69add6273dd3b13790e078534dea927375d45056 832f33550d874e92afb993aeb7a87109afb4fc7c 91929d0235b1f3e6bbe09e64b710d58a85fbc35c ce16403eae58d8e9458428291c4d79bef7e71255 ed00803e6b30159b630810d74aca0837e94aa3cb eda0ac7ccb363c2ef66777be71e477a5ebcf6bd5

Control files of package libfreenect-demos: lines which differ (wdiff format)

  • Priority: extra optional

Control files of package libfreenect-dev: lines which differ (wdiff format)

  • Priority: extra optional

Control files of package libfreenect-doc: lines which differ (wdiff format)

  • Priority: extra optional

Control files of package libfreenect0.5: lines which differ (wdiff format)

  • Priority: extra optional

Control files of package libfreenect0.5-dbgsym: lines which differ (wdiff format)

  • Build-Ids: 44549963e2cf16eedca0b1e342f8fca72a3ca42a 5b23091c1586a4cbd8ceea3ad2b519edb64bec4e a9abb32e861c1127db41817894d13749760a741e bee27fae634e30ac2f55e7634970521f4733f0f8 c120c344d35e8a94b08c28754058156176ec708f

Control files of package python-freenect: lines which differ (wdiff format)

  • Priority: extra optional

Control files of package python-freenect-dbgsym: lines which differ (wdiff format)

  • Build-Ids: deb434bc03f073e4419df32f2cd635614a47bf89 35d23881f6bca711f02b915612a8590fdb581118

Run locally

Try this locally (using the lintian-brush package):

debcheckout libfreenect
cd libfreenect
lintian-brush

More details

Full run details